Abstract
An antenna module includes an antenna, a connecting member attached to the antenna, a sliding board configured for sliding relative to connecting member, and a radiation member attached to the sliding board. When the sliding board is slid by a user, the radiation member makes contact with or separates from the connecting member, enabling one antenna module to receive and transmit wireless signals of different wavelengths.
